The Foundations: What Demography Studies
Demography is the scientific study of human populations, primarily with respect to their size, structure (composition), and development over time. The field rests on the analysis of three fundamental processes: fertility (births), mortality (deaths), and migration (movement in and out of a specific area). Changes in any of these components directly alter a population's size and characteristics. For instance, a sustained drop in fertility rates leads to an older average age, while significant in-migration can rapidly rejuvenate a population's age structure. Demographers use tools like censuses, vital registration systems, and surveys to collect this data, transforming raw numbers into insights about societal trends. Understanding these core components is the first step in deciphering the complex story populations tell.
The Essential Tool: Interpreting Population Pyramids
A population pyramid (or age-sex structure diagram) is the most powerful visual tool in demography. It is a graphical illustration that shows the distribution of various age groups in a population, typically separated by gender, with the youngest cohorts at the bottom and the oldest at the top. The shape of the pyramid is a snapshot of a population's history and its future trajectory. A pyramid with a wide base and narrow top (a classic "pyramid" shape) indicates a high birth rate and a young population, common in many developing nations. A more column-like or even urn-shaped pyramid, with roughly equal proportions across age groups and a bulging elderly cohort, signifies low birth and death rates and an aging population, characteristic of countries like Japan or Italy. By reading these shapes, you can immediately infer challenges related to education, labor supply, and elder care.
The Core Process: The Demographic Transition
The demographic transition is a fundamental model describing the shift from high birth and death rates to low birth and death rates that occurs as a society develops economically. This transition is typically conceptualized in four stages. Stage 1 (Pre-Industrial) features high, fluctuating birth and death rates, resulting in minimal population growth. Stage 2 (Early Industrial) sees death rates begin to fall due to improvements in sanitation, food supply, and medicine, while birth rates remain high, leading to a rapid population explosion. In Stage 3 (Late Industrial), birth rates start to decline due to urbanization, increased education (particularly for women), and changing economic incentives regarding children, slowing population growth. Finally, Stage 4 (Post-Industrial) is marked by low and stable birth and death rates, with population growth nearing zero. Some theorists add a Stage 5, where death rates exceed birth rates, leading to population decline. This model explains the different fertility trends and growth patterns observed between developed and developing regions today.
Major Contemporary Shifts: Aging and Urbanization
Two dominant global trends are redefining societies: population aging and urbanization. An aging population is a direct result of the demographic transition—specifically, extended life expectancy (lowered mortality) coupled with sustained low fertility. This shift creates a higher proportion of older adults relative to working-age individuals, a metric measured by the old-age dependency ratio. The implications are profound, pressuring pension systems, demanding more healthcare resources, and potentially slowing economic growth if not managed through policy or technology.
Concurrently, urbanization patterns show a relentless global movement of people from rural to urban areas. This is driven by the "pull" of perceived economic opportunity, education, and services in cities and the "push" of mechanization and limited prospects in agriculture. Urbanization concentrates human capital and innovation but also creates challenges like housing shortages, infrastructure strain, and environmental pollution. Understanding the pace and scale of urbanization is critical for planning sustainable cities.
How Demographic Shapes Society: Impacts and Implications
Demographic shifts are not passive background noise; they actively drive change in every sector of society. Their effects on economies are direct: a large, young working-age population (a "demographic dividend") can fuel rapid economic growth if coupled with job creation and investment, while an aging population may lead to labor shortages and increased fiscal burdens. Politics are shaped as the interests and voting power of different age cohorts evolve; policies on immigration, education, and retirement are often demographic battlegrounds.
Perhaps the most visible impacts are on healthcare systems and social programs. An older population requires a shift from acute, infectious disease care to chronic disease management, long-term care, and geriatric specialties. Social programs like public pensions face sustainability tests as fewer workers support more retirees. Conversely, a youth-heavy population demands massive investment in schools, pediatric health, and youth employment programs. In essence, demography sets the parameters within which social and economic policy must operate.
Common Pitfalls
- Confusing Population Size with Growth Rate: A country with a large population (e.g., the United States) can have a slow growth rate, while a smaller country can be growing rapidly. Focus on the rates of change (fertility, mortality, migration) to understand dynamics, not just the total number.
- Misinterpreting a Population Pyramid's "Bulge": A bulge in the working-age cohort, often called a "youth bulge," is frequently cited as a source of economic potential. However, this is only true if the economy can generate sufficient jobs. Without opportunity, a youth bulge can lead to social instability and increased unemployment.
- Assuming Demographic Transition is Inevitable or Uniform: The classic model is a generalization based on historical European experience. Some societies may stall in Stage 2 or 3, and the pace and drivers of transition (like the role of women's empowerment) can vary significantly across cultures. Applying the model rigidly can lead to flawed predictions.
- Overlooking the Role of Migration: In national-level analysis, it's easy to focus solely on births and deaths. However, for many regions, cities, and countries, migration is the primary driver of demographic change, instantly altering age structures and cultural composition in ways that natural increase cannot.
